Another cool homebrew for the Oric, Pulsoids was originally published on ZX Spectum, Amstrad CPC and Commodore 64 in 1988. This great game adaptation from Jonathan "Twilighte" Bristow, released in 2002, is mostly inspired by the C64 version.

Pulsoïds was the first Oric game to use the AIC video mode which provides a rich color palette while limiting the artifacts and other attribute-clashes.

The game exploits nicely the floppy drive by providing many levels, introduction screen, SID music, and also saved high-scores.

This is the complete walk through for this early French text adventure game. "Le Manoir du Docteur Genius" was released in 1983 by Loriciels for the Oric-1 and Oric Atmos micro computers. It was also later released for the Sinclair ZX Spectrum.

Like many of this genre it must have been inspired by the success of Mystery House for the Apple II, the first graphic adventure game. Enter the Dr Genius mansion, and then try to get out!

The game is entirely in French. The text interpreter is pretty simple and very slow. You can only enter a maximum of two words. The entire game was programmed in BASIC!

Doggy for the Oric by Loriciels

http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=78QY_oZARKE

The most interesting thing about this game is that it was written by one Eric Chahi who would go on to develop the smash hit game Another World (also known as Out Of This World).
